SCOTT EAGLES
Head Coach: Dave Campbell (12-30 @ Scott, four years, 12-30 overall)
2011 Record: 4-6, 1-3

Overview: Head coach Dave Campbell sees the light and the end of the tunnel for Scott football. The Eagles have never had a winning season. The 2012 team looks to change all that. This could be a monumental campaign for the program. Scott will call upon a large contingent of juniors to take it up a level. No matter what this team will have to make their own breaks if they want to jump this hurdle.

A big group of players line up across the front for the Scott offense and defense. Chase Ford and Trevor Evans set the tone. They combined for 7.0 sacks in 2011. Brandon Edmonds is also poised for big year. Juniors Nathan Penick, Corey Fitzwater, Blake Gay and Kameron Crim will also make impacts this fall. Classmates Jordan Smith, Josh Castleman, Nick Thurza and Chris Roberts are proven commodities in the defensive back seven.

Ben Osborne should be more comfortable in his second season under center. He threw for 525 yards and ran for another 297 while accounting for eight touchdowns as a sophomore. Look for Smith, Roberts, Castleman and Reed Sparta to contribute heavily at the skill positions. Fitzwater and Crim have college potential on the line.
